Choosing Materials for Energy-Saving Sliding Doors

Picking the right materials for energy-efficient sliding doors is necessary to improving their operation and visual charm. Standard materials include vinyl, fiberglass, and wood, each delivering unique benefits. Vinyl is celebrated for its outstanding insulation properties and low maintenance requirements, making it a popular choice. Fiberglass offers toughness and resistance to warping, while also providing good energy efficiency. Wood, though aesthetically pleasing, often requires more maintenance and may need supplemental insulation to meet energy standards.

The determination of glazing also plays a critical component. Double or triple-pane glass with low-emissivity coatings can greatly reduce heat transfer, enhancing energy economy. Additionally, opting frames with thermal breaks can additionally improve insulation. All things considered, a attentive examination of material options, merged with energy-efficient features, certifies that sliding doors not only enhance the home's presentation but also contribute to lower energy costs and amplified comfort.

How to Set Up Energy-Saving Sliding Doors

Putting in energy-efficient sliding doors requires thorough preparation and implementation to guarantee peak performance and longevity. First, the existing door frame must be precisely measured to ascertain a exact fit. The taking out of the prior door should be done with care, avoiding damage to the surrounding structure. Once the area is prepared, the additional glass door can be positioned into the opening. Ensuring that the door is level and plumb is necessary; shims may be necessary for modifications. After securing the door, proper insulation around the frame is critical to prevent air leaks. The setup should feature weather stripping to enhance energy efficiency. Finally, the door's operation should be tested to verify smooth sliding and tight locks. This systematic method not only enhances energy efficiency but also supports the aesthetic appeal and functionality of the dwelling.

Best Strategies for Servicing Sliding Doors

Proper installation of high-efficiency sliding doors sets the foundation for their durability, but ongoing maintenance is equally important to ensure peak performance. Regular cleaning is vital; channels should be emptied of dust and particles to prevent obstruction and guarantee seamless functioning. Homeowners should inspect the weather seals periodically for any deterioration or harm, changing it as required to preserve energy efficiency.

Applying silicone lubricant to the track system can enhance functionality and minimize deterioration. It is also recommended to verify proper alignment of the doors; improper alignment can lead to gaps, which undermines energy efficiency. Additionally, examining the panes for cracks or chips will help avoid further damage and energy loss. By adhering to these best practices, homeowners can prolong the life of their sliding doors while optimizing energy efficiency gains. Often Asked Questions

How Much Do Average Energy-Saving Sliding Doors Cost?

The standard cost of high-efficiency sliding doors commonly ranges from $800 to $3,000, affected by materials, size, and installation. Residents should weigh long-term savings on energy bills when reviewing their purchase in these doors.

How Stack Sliding Doors Up Against Traditional Doors for Energy Efficiency?

Sliding doors typically provide superior energy efficiency relative to traditional doors, primarily because of their state-of-the-art insulation and sealing technologies. This design reduces air leaks, strengthening thermal performance and lowering heating and cooling costs in homes.

Can I Retrofit Existing Doors for Improved Energy Efficiency?

Improving current doors for superior energy performance is feasible through weatherproofing, incorporating insulation, or installing high-performance glass. These changes can boost insulation and reduce energy loss, making older doors more efficient without full replacement.

Can Energy-Efficient Sliding Doors Be Eligible for Tax Credits or Cashback Offers?

Energy-efficient glass doors may qualify for tax credits or rebates, depending on local and federal programs. Homeowners should review specific eligibility requirements and consult with tax professionals to increase potential financial benefits.

Which Coverage Options Can You Find for Energy-Efficient Sliding Doors?

Various warranties for energy-saving sliding doors include manufacturer warranties, which often protect against defects for 10-20 years, and limited lifetime warranties that may cover specific components. Homeowners should examine terms to guarantee adequate protection against potential issues.
